I would stay with Jacks you don’t need to use cal mag. Mix part A 3.6 per gallon 1.2 apsom salt, and 2.4 part B in that order, mix between adding. Are you adding anything else? Sounds like you have the watering down, if that hot, yes probably every day. When feeding make sure you put enough though to get a little run off, if it’s a def. You should see improvements in a week or so, but from what I see it’s nothing to worry about yet.

Update : today marks day 80 of my 1st grow ,im not sure where i should be in terms of flowering. Im confused on how to count the days . They started flowing 2 weeks ago do i count the total days of flowering until harvest or total in all the whole life span…?? Or does it matter . Like i posted above i started my grow on may 5th for the purple haze and the 6th for grand daddy purp and london pound cake so this would b day 79 / 80. He are a few close ups and a few later not close up. Please give me your thoughts …what to do ,what not to do





3 Likes

I would still be in veg, as them are just showing there sex. It won’t be long though before they start the transition. I start the count down once they just start to form a bud sight. Check out @Cantgetnosatisfaction grow he has some that have begun.
